If your truck or vehicle displays rear end sag when towing a trailer or hauling a heavy load, it’s important to address the rear end sag by finding a proper solution that levels the vehicle. Truck sag, also referred to as truck squat, is the visible effect of payload on the rear end axle, causing the nose of the vehicle to shoot upwards while the back end tilts downward. Some folks underestimate the severity of driving a vehicle in this position. The handling dynamic of your vehicle will suffer greatly.
With rear end sag, you’ll experience these side effects: Uneven tire footprint
- Increased braking distance, inability to stop
- Steering is completely thrown off -- steering is loose or has a feeling of ‘floating’ because the vehicle’s maneuvering capabilities are unresponsive
- Misaligned steering leads to increased tire wear and uneven tire footprint, which can potentially decrease your fuel mileage
Inability to gain control

How does the lower quick-disconnect StableLoad application correct rear end sag? The StableLoads effectively reduce the amount of rear end sag by pre-activating the vehicle’s factory overload leaf springs. Not only for trucks, the StableLoads universally fit on any truck, van, SUV and light commercial vehicles that come equipped with overload leaf springs.
By occupying the gap between the leaf spring pack and lower overload, the stabilizing effect of the leaf springs are activated much sooner. With the factory suspension put to use as it’s designed, you experience a leveled vehicle and reduction in stressful handling characteristics such as side-to-side sway, body roll and porpoising.
The condition of leaf springs is different on each vehicle, meaning the space or clearance between the upper leaf spring pack and lower overload leaf spring varies. Each StableLoad comes with three specially designed wedges that are adjustable to accommodate this.
